Damaged Window Repair in Kansas City, KS
Damaged window repair services address issues caused by breakage, cracks, or other forms of damage to residential or commercial windows. These projects can include replacing shattered glass, fixing cracks, or restoring windows that have been compromised due to impact or weather-related incidents. Property owners typically seek this service to improve security, prevent further damage, and restore the appearance of their property. Before requesting repairs, it’s helpful to understand the extent of the damage, the type of window involved, and whether the existing window can be repaired or if a replacement is necessary.
Homeowners and property owners should consider factors such as the size and location of the damage, the age and material of the window, and any specific preferences for glass or frame types. Clarifying these details can help determine the most effective repair approach and ensure that the window’s integrity and functionality are restored properly. Proper assessment and timely repairs can help maintain the safety, security, and aesthetic appeal of a property after window damage occurs.

Common Damaged Window Repair Jobs
Broken Window Repair - restores windows with cracks or shattering to improve safety and appearance.
Cracked Glass Replacement - replaces damaged glass panes to prevent further damage and maintain insulation.
Frame Damage Repair - fixes or replaces window frames affected by rot, warping, or impact.
Storm Window Repair - restores or replaces storm windows to enhance protection against weather elements.
Seal and Weatherproofing - repairs damaged seals to improve energy efficiency and prevent drafts.
Emergency Window Repair - provides quick fixes for broken or compromised windows after accidents or storms.
Damaged Window Repair Questions
What types of window damage can be repaired? Damage such as cracks, chips, or broken glass can often be repaired or replaced to restore window integrity.
Is it possible to fix a cracked window without replacing the entire pane? Yes, minor cracks and chips can sometimes be repaired with specialized sealing or patching techniques.
When should a damaged window be replaced instead of repaired? If the damage is extensive, affects the window’s structural stability, or involves multiple cracks, replacement may be recommended.
What are common causes of window damage? Impact from objects, severe weather, or age-related wear are common reasons for window damage in homes and properties.
